What is the customer charge on my bill?

Entergy Louisiana - Frequently Asked Questions
The customer charge is a flat fee that covers the cost associated with billing. This fee covers items like meter reading, payment processing and postage.

What's included in the monthly customer charge?

Frequently Asked Questions
This is a fixed charge, regardless of how much gas is used, to cover costs associated with maintaining a gas service account including meter reading, billing and administrative costs, as well as a portion of the system costs associated with providing availability of gas service. Back to Top

I am a new customer. Why is there an additional charge to turn my gas on?

Frequently Asked Questions
The additional charge covers the cost of performing the required safety test, turning on the meter, lighting the gas appliances, and the Utility Customer Service costs to establish the account and process the deposit. Back to Top

What is a Customer Charge?

FortisBC: Frequently Asked Questions
A customer charge is applied every 2 month billing period. This charge recovers a portion of, among other things, the cost of assets that remain in place whether or not power is actually consumed. This includes not only readily visible things such as your transformer, meter and drop service, but also the distribution lines, transmission lines and substations which must remain in place whether or not electricity is consumed.

On my Electric bill, what is the Customer Charge?

Frequently Asked Questions
This fixed monthly charge is the basic fee for your electric service. It does not fluctuate with usage and does not include any consumption. This fee is intended to cover our costs of maintaining and keeping your customer account records active (data processing, meter reading, billing, etc.). If you have absolutely no electric consumption, the Customer Charge will be your only electric bill.

What is a Basic Customer Charge?

Cascade Natural Gas
This charge covers a portion of the costs associated with meter reading and billing, return on investment, property taxes and depreciation for meters, regulators and service lines. These fixed costs do not vary with the amount of natural gas used.

Why do I have to pay a customer charge each month?

frequently asked questions
This charge covers the cost of providing you with service, whether or not you actually use any electricity. This portion of your bill covers expenses such as metering, billing, and maintaining your service drop. This cost is spread equally among customers with your rate classification.

What is a customer connection charge?

Bill questions and answers
The customer connection charge is a one-time charge that helps cover the cost of setting up your new electric service account. In North Dakota the connection charge is $9. In Minnesota and South Dakota the connection charge is $15.

What is the customer charge or minimum charge that appears on my bill?

Bill questions and answers
The customer or minimum charge on your monthly statement helps to recover costs for poles, wires, meters, customer service, and billing services that are associated with providing your electric service.

What is the responsibility of the person-in-charge when a customer or employee lights up indoors?

Frequently Asked Questions about the Omaha Smoke-Free Law
The person-in-charge of the business must ask that individual to stop smoking inside the building. Failure to do so could result in a citation to the owner and manager as well as to the person smoking.
